Position: Operations Manager (Fully Remote)

  • * Overview*

• You will be responsible for day to day operations of the project which includes, but is not limited to, people leadership, new processes implementation, performance management, SLA development, training, critical issue resolution, ongoing workforce planning, business reviews and day-to-day vendor relationship management.

  • * Responsibilities*

• +

  • * Workflow and process management** - Develop and consistently meet and report on SLAs. Create SOPs and documentation as needed and ensure they're updated regularly. Continually optimize workflows for both client and team members. Review team member data, develop QA frameworks and report on team performance and metrics via MBRs/QBRs. Develop and manage project trackers, timelines, and lead cross functional groups to deliver on project objectives.

+

  • * Process Improvement** - Review vendor data, identify workflow process improvement opportunities and drive improvement of vendor performance and SLA compliance.

+

  • * Project Management** - Manage cross-functional projects and teams by working with business stakeholders across the organization as well as manage multiple projects with competing priorities simultaneously. Develop/manage project trackers, timelines, and lead cross functional groups to deliver on project objectives. Synthesize feedback and communicate progress regularly to stakeholders

+

  • * Stakeholder management** - Work with a global team of stakeholders to ensure client needs are being met. Synthesize feedback and communicate progress regularly to stakeholders. Intake new workflow requests from stakeholders and collaborate to implement them.

+

  • * Team management** - Create a clear and organized structure for a global team. Hold regular 1:1s with team members. Develop and implement feedback channels for team members and conduct performance reviews and improvement plans. Ensure the team is adequately staffed at all times, conduct interviews, make hiring decisions and work with recruiters to manage the hiring process. Develop, execute and oversee training programs.

Identify, document and mitigate HR issues. Review timesheets and expense reports.
